Hi guys. Just need some advice. Ive been taking Champix for a week (Starter Pack) Just taken first 1mg tablet but don't feel any effect regarding smoking less. When does Champix begin to take its course. My quit date is day 14 which is this Sunday. Many thanks and have a fantastic day

Hi and welcome ddw. Congrats on taking your first steps to quitting. I am also using Champix, with success. It varies with everyone but for me it happened gradually and around the week 2 mark. I didnt really choose a quit date as I felt it made me feel anxious. I noticed i wasnt smoking as much, they tasted awful and the last day i smoked was when I knew it was quit day. It was my one and only smoke for the day and in the morning..and i didnt even finish it, stubbed it out and that was it. Good luck on your journey and keep us posted.

welcome ddw, I also used Champix, I smoked normal right up to my date. Then on my quit date I didn't smoke anymore, not as easy as it sounds I had to find a lot of willpower especially that first 24 hours but my head was in the right place and this time I was not going to smoke.

Today i am smoke free 90 days after over 45 years of smoking it gets better as time goes on but I still think about smoking more than I would like, and some days are are horrible and I think maybe I can't do this, then realise I am doing this one day at a time. Try to not put to much pressure on yourself smoke til your date if you need to everyone is different.
